Cambridge Audio Azur 840C up-sampling CD player The 840C marks the zenith of Cambridge Audio’s critically acclaimed Azur line up. Like all Azur products, the 840C promises unseen levels of performance and engineering excellence to the price points in question. But rather than redefining expectations in the entry-level market, the arena most often associated with Cambridge Audio, the company will reinvigorate the mid-end price sector.
|
Adaptive Time Filtering (ATF) asynchronous up-sampling technology converting 16-bit 44.1 kHz CD data to 24-bit 384kHz |
32-bit Analog Devices Black Fin DSP |
Dual differential DAC configuration using high-end Analog Devices AD1955 DACs |
Fully differential anti-aliasing topolopgy based on linear phase Bessel filters |
DC servo circuitry with no capacitors in the signal path |
Two digital inputs allowing up-sampling and playback of other sources |
Digital outputs allow recording of up-sampled audio |
Control Bus In/Out, IR emitter in and RS232 for easy multi-room compatibility |
Extruded aluminium side panels and solid aluminium front panel plus an ultra rigid, acoustically dampened chassis |
Navigator style Azur remote control which also controls Azur amplifiers |
Available in silver or black |

Cambridge Audio DacMagic, Digital to Analogue Converter The multi award-winning DacMagic is the world’s most affordable and effective way to upgrade any PC, Mac, network music player, digital iPod dock, games console or any device with a Digital Audio out to truly high end sound quality.
|
Adaptive Time Filtering (ATF™) asynchronous upsampling technology converts 16-24 bit audio (at any standard sampling frequency between 32-96kHz) to 24 bit/192kHz |
32 bit Texas Instruments Digital Signal Processor (DSP) |
Dual Differential Virtual Earth balanced filter topology – low order two pole linear-phased Bessel filter takes advantage of high sampling rate achieved |
Twin WM8740 high quality DACs in dual differential mode for excellent stereo imaging |
Incoming sampling rate indicator 32/44.1/48/88.2/96kHz |
Choice of filters – linear phase, minimum phase and steep filter can all be selected to suit an individual’s listening preferences |
Phase select to invert or reinvert input, correcting possible recording problems |
Two inputs with both SPDIF & Toslink sockets allow wide range of digital sources to be connected |
USB input connects direct to PC without drivers to act as very high quality DAC/soundcard providing genuine hi-fi quality playback from desktop or media PC |
Singled ended phono and XLR balanced audio outputs |
Digital output (SPDIF and Toslink concurrently) passes through selected source for recording purposes |
Substantial aluminium front panel plus an entirely new ultra rigid, acoustically dampened chassis |
Can be used horizontally (using four rubber feet) or vertically (rubber foot) |
Available in silver or black |
